Why Solar Water Pumps Are Changing the Game
Solar water pumps have become a cost-effective and eco-friendly solution for water supply in remote areas. Unlike diesel pumps, they eliminate fuel costs, reduce carbon emissions, and require minimal maintenance. But with multiple options available, how do you choose the right one? Let's break down the three main types and their best uses.
Type 1: Submersible Solar Pumps
Imagine a pump that works like a marathon runner – quiet, efficient, and built for deep wells. Submersible solar pumps are designed to operate underwater, making them ideal for:
- Deep boreholes (up to 200 meters)
- Agricultural irrigation in arid regions
- Village water supply systems

Type 2: Surface Solar Pumps
Think of these as the sprinters of the solar pump world. Surface pumps excel in shallow water sources like ponds or rivers. Key applications include:
- Livestock watering
- Small-scale irrigation
- Fish farming

Type 3: Centrifugal Solar Pumps
Need high flow rates for short durations? Centrifugal pumps act like firehoses, delivering large volumes of water quickly. They're perfect for:
- Flood irrigation
- Emergency water supply
- Industrial tank filling
Real-World Impact: Data You Can Trust
| Pump Type | Average Daily Output | Lifespan | Best For |
|---|---|---|---|
| Submersible | 10,000–50,000 liters | 8–12 years | Deep wells |
| Surface | 5,000–20,000 liters | 6–10 years | Shallow sources |
| Centrifugal | 15,000–60,000 liters | 5–8 years | High-volume tasks |

Choosing Your Pump: 3 Quick Questions
- What's your water source depth? (Deep = Submersible)
- How much daily water do you need? (High volume = Centrifugal)
- Is mobility important? (Surface pumps are lightweight)
